General Settings Overview
Manage your account, organization, and platform preferences: from personal settings to integrations, security, and branding.
The Settings page lets you manage your account, personalize the platform experience, and control preferences. Here’s a breakdown of what you can configure.
To access settings, click your profile icon in the top-right corner of the screen.
1. Account Settings
Manage your personal profile and application preferences.
Basic Settings:
-
First & Last Name: Edit how your name appears in Caplena.
-
Email Address: Used for notifications, password resets, and communication.
General Information:
-
Profile Created: See when your account was created.
-
Last Login: Monitor your recent login activity.
Application Preferences:
-
Language: Choose between English and German.
-
Theme: Switch between Light and Dark mode.
2. Organization Settings
Configure company-wide preferences and billing details.
Billing Information:
-
Add or update your Company Name, Address, City, ZIP, and Country.
-
This info appears on all invoices.
-
Don’t forget to click Save after making changes.
Organization Preferences:
-
Dummy Values: Define up to 3 placeholders (e.g., -99, NULL) to exclude from billing.
-
Tracking: Opt out of usage tracking for support/debugging.
💡 Note: Dummy values only apply to newly uploaded data.
You can also view your Credit Usage on this page, and export it if needed.

4. API Settings
Generate and manage API keys for external integrations.
To create an API key:
-
Go to Settings → API tab
-
Click Generate New API Key
-
Copy & store it securely — you won’t see it again
5. Security Settings
Keep your account secure with password management and 2FA.
Change Password:
-
Enter your current and new password → click Save
Two-Factor Authentication (2FA):
-
Add protection via:
-
Authenticator App
-
Phone Number
-
Backup Codes
-
-
You can set up to 3 active methods
